The decode: where the internet's advice stops, and what lives below it
Credit first, because his reasoning deserves it: the MBR theory was intelligent (a corrupted boot record is a classic no-volumes culprit) and his own falsification of it was better — no media presented means nothing for an MBR to even sit on, so the fault sat deeper, and "the hardware has failed" was the correct reading of the evidence. The web's consensus wasn't wrong about the diagnosis. It was answering the wrong question. General advice about dead flash drives optimises for the device: sticks are cheap, repair is uneconomic, replacements are everywhere — so for the object itself, the bin is genuinely the rational verdict, and the internet says so in ten thousand forum threads. But his question was never about the object; "really important and not backed up" is a question about the data — and the data's fate and the hardware's fate are separate facts, because a USB stick is two residents on one board: the controller (the spokesman, which had died — hence a device with no volumes, his exact symptom) and the flash memory (the vault, which almost always survives its spokesman). Below the point where consumer guidance stops — below software, below diagnostics, below the bin — sits chip-off recovery: the memory accessed directly, the dead controller's private translation rebuilt offline, the filesystem raised from silicon that never knew anything was wrong. The internet's advice wasn't refuted at the bench that morning. It was completed: bin the hardware, by all means — after the vault has been emptied.
The recovery — same morning in, verified out
His drop-off request was honoured as asked — assessed the morning it arrived — and the route ran exactly as the decode maps: the stick opened, the flash read at chip level on the VNR, and the controller's translation reconstructed from the memory's own metadata until the volume the PC could never find stood whole on the bench. The really-important, never-backed-up files came out and were verified by opening them across the set; delivery went onto new media in duplicate — the second copy non-negotiable for an archive whose entire existence had just depended on one £10 device's spokesman — and the stick itself went back with the report, formally cleared for the fate the internet had prescribed all along. Separate the two questions: "is the hardware finished?" and "is the data gone?" have independent answers, and general advice online almost always addresses the first — reasonably, since it can't know your backup situation — so read every "just bin it" as silently appending "...if nothing on it matters." If something matters, the sentence changes: hardware failure is precisely the condition chip-level recovery exists for, controller deaths are its most routine patient, and the flash behind a dead spokesman holds its contents for years. When the internet says bin it
Ask which question the advice answers: device-value or data-value. If the stick holds nothing important, the consensus is right — bin it. If it holds the only copy of something that matters, hardware failure is the start of recovery, not the end of hope: don't dismantle it yourself, don't keep re-plugging it, and say what's at stake in your enquiry. Chip-level work lives below where the search results stop — and after the recovery, the bin advice becomes correct again.
